Abstract :
In this article, the authors study querying binary large objects (blobs) such as video and voice clips in a network of vehicles communicating wirelessly. They introduce a novel paradigm, describe a set of derived query-processing strategies and compare them along three dimensions: push versus pull, whether or not a communication infrastructure is utilized, and whether metadata dissemination is separated from blob dissemination. They analyze these strategies theoretically and experimentally in terms of answer throughput and communication overhead.
